Open Rank Faculty Position in Nature-based Climate Solutions
Stanford University invites applications for an Assistant, Associate, or Full Professor in Nature-based Climate Solutions. Nature can be a powerful ally in combating and coping with climate change. Examples of nature-based solutions include strategies to increase carbon storage on land and oceans, as well as nature-based strategies that help people and economies cope with climate change. We invite candidates that have completed or will soon complete their PhD in a broad range of areas (including but not limited to natural sciences, engineering, and social sciences) to apply. We encourage applicants at all levels to apply. The successful candidate will serve as faculty in Stanford’s Doerr School of Sustainability.
